THIS IS NOT GRAFFITI depicts JONONE's physical relationship with painting and intense personality. His love for boxing results from an unconditional need for self-expression and places some interesting light on the development of a movement which has made its way to the art auctions halls. Those who made this long and difficult path were the genuine artists. THIS IS NOT GRAFFITI is an introspective look back at JONONE's 30 years career which places the present days not as an end, bu as a beginning!
JONONE is an iconic and extremely prolific artist born in New york city and living in Paris (France) for more than 20 years, he received the french egion of Honour on the 21st of JAnuary 2015, and a painting which he specifically produced is being exhibited in the national assembly's public part.

Living Decay (fairy tales in the middle of nowhere)

“Living Decay ” project 2008 \ 2012 In the amazing set of the Lofoten Islands in the North of Norway, two Norwegian artists, Dolk e Pøbel, make huge paintings on the walls of abandoned houses bringing them back to life. “Living Decay”: a documentary about painting and seagulls, spray and clouds, landscape and empty houses in the middle of nowhere. In the summer of 2008 the two talented Norwegian street artists took on the challenge of Lofoten Islands countryside in Norway to create large-scale murales on the faces of abandoned houses which are about to be demolished. “Living Decay” is suggestive daily log that narrates through seven chapters, the making of these huge paintings inside the unique northern landscape. The documentary opens and closes with the narration by the American artist John Fekner, pioneer of ’70 street art.
